Object history
  • by 1760
    date QS:P,+1760-00-00T00:00:00Z/7,P1326,+1760-00-00T00:00:00Z/9
    : Gerard Hoet (†1760), The Hague
  • 25 August 1760: sale of the collection of Gerard Hoet, The Hague, at an unknown auction house, The Hague
  • by 1763 (?): Johann Ernst Gotzkowsky (1710-1775), Berlin
  • 1763: acquired by Catherine II of Russia, Saint Petersburg
  • by 1931 (?): Hermitage, Saint Petersburg
  • January 1931: purchased by Andrew W. Mellon (1855-1937), Pittsburgh/Washington, D.C., through Matthiesen Gallery, Berlin, P. & D. Colnaghi & Co., London, & M. Knoedler & Co., New York City (as Rembrandt)
  • 1 May 1937: ownership transferred to The A.W. Mellon Educational and Charitable Trust, Pittsburgh
  • 1937: given to National Gallery of Art, Washington, D.C.
